Output 43bb5243198a9f9be43b31cf3a002d0620f02090c77325fb50817264a9471de4:95

value
23049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f55118a57369e53581263617f77d1eefa32d846 OP_EQUAL
address
361HbDwiDd6bHFAWdS5UE6QunCWc7ZEqYm
transaction
43bb5243198a9f9be43b31cf3a002d0620f02090c77325fb50817264a9471de4
spent
true